Prayer should be ‘in the Spirit’“praying always with all prayer and supplication in the Spirit, being watchful to this end with all perseverance and supplication for all the saints—” (Ephesians Although the scriptures refer specifically to praying in tongues as praying ‘in the spirit’, more generally it refers to all prayer. God is a Spirit (John Mary Alice Isleib says: “Praying in the spirit doesn’t mean to pray just in tongues. What does is mean, then? It means to pray out of your spirit, aware of the presence of the Holy Spirit. It means to pray all prayer – all the different kinds of prayer – in the presence of the Holy Spirit, in the realm of the spirit, out of your inner man.”
